The TeSys LX1LB340 is a replacement coil for TeSys contactors, not a complete contactor assembly. Coil draws 75 VA inrush at 0.55 power factor, dropping to 8 VA sealed at 0.28 power factor — the sealed hold power is what matters for continuous duty in a panel, keeping heat rise manageable inside the contactor enclosure.
Rated coil resistance is 1060.99 Ohm ±10 % at 68 °F (20 °C). If you are bench-testing a contactor that chatters or fails to pull in, measuring resistance across the coil terminals against this value confirms whether the winding is open or shorted before you swap the part. Inductance is 6.6 H — this governs the magnetizing current and the time constant of the coil circuit. For a 50 Hz supply the inductive reactance is roughly 2 kΩ, which aligns with the sealed VA figure.
